Top destinations for hotels in Nepal

Nepal's unique geography and rich cultural heritage significantly influence its hotel distribution. From the bustling streets of its capital to serene mountain towns, travelers can find accommodations that cater to various needs and budgets across diverse landscapes.

Kathmandu
The capital city buzzes with life and offers countless hotel options for visitors seeking cultural immersion.

  • Hotel Yak & Yeti – A luxurious blend of history and modern amenities.
  • Dwarika's Hotel – Traditional Newari architecture with a boutique experience.
  • Thamel Eco Resort – Budget-friendly with green practices in the heart of Thamel.
  • Kathmandu Guest House – A historic institution known for its vibrant atmosphere.

Pokhara
Known for its stunning lakes and views of the Annapurna range, Pokhara is perfect for adventure seekers.

  • Fishtail Lodge – Unique hotel located on an island in Phewa Lake.
  • Temple Tree Resort & Spa – A blend of luxury and traditional design close to nature.
  • Waterfront Resort – Relaxing lakeside views with great hospitality.

Chitwan National Park
This region attracts wildlife enthusiasts looking for an unforgettable jungle experience.

  • Barahi Jungle Lodge – Luxury resort situated near the park's entrance.
  • Green Park Chitwan – Eco-friendly accommodations within lush surroundings.
  • Narayani Safari Lodge – Great value with cozy rooms and personalized service.

Bhaktapur
Famous for its medieval architecture, this cultural hub offers a range of charming hotels.

  • Hotel Heritage – Traditional design with modern comforts.
  • Bhaktapur Paradise Hotel – Offers stunning views and easy access to the Durbar Square.

Hotel price ranges and practical info

Hotel prices in Nepal vary significantly, depending on the type of accommodation and location. Budget hotels can cost as little as $10 per night, while mid-range accommodations typically range from $30 to $80. Luxury hotels often start from $100 and can go much higher for premium experiences.

  • Average tipping is around 10% for good service.
  • Local taxes often apply, typically around 13% VAT on hotel stays.
  • Popular booking platforms include Booking.com and local travel agencies.
  • Many hotels offer breakfast included in the room rate; check in advance.
  • Check-in times are usually around 2 PM, and check-out is at noon.
  • Local payment methods often include cash in Nepalese Rupees and credit cards in larger establishments.
  • Taxis and rideshare services are generally available from major airports or hotels.
  • Be aware of seasonal demand; May to September can be quieter due to monsoon weather.

Unique stays and heritage hotels in Nepal

Nepal is rich in history and offers many unique stays that reflect its cultural heritage. Options range from ancient palaces to eco-lodges nestled in the mountains.

Dwarika’s Hotel, Kathmandu
This hotel is a beautifully restored heritage property that showcases traditional Newari architecture, offering luxurious rooms and a glimpse into the past.

Krishna Villa, Bhaktapur
Set in one of Nepal's ancient cities, this guesthouse is a charming representation of local culture with guest rooms overlooking the historic square.

Patan Dhoka, Patan
A heritage hotel set in a historic palace, it provides a unique opportunity to live within the walls of history while enjoying modern comforts.

Himalayan Eco Resort, Langtang Valley
A sustainable lodge immersed in nature, combining rustic charm and eco-friendly practices, ideal for trekking enthusiasts.

Hotel Kakhrebhal, Nepalganj
This unique accommodation features traditional Tharu architecture along with scenic views of the surrounding nature.

Gosaikunda Guesthouse, Gosaikunda
A simple yet memorable stay, providing lodgings close to the sacred lakes in the Langtang region, perfect for trekkers and spiritual seekers.
